In the Kherson region, as of 21.00 on Friday, the average water level is 1.49 meters, 11 settlements remain flooded on the right bank, and water has receded from 140 houses.
According to Censor.NET, the head of the regional administration, Oleksandr Prokudin, reported on the situation in the flooded areas in a telegram.
"As of 21.00, the average water level is 1.49 meters. On the right bank, 11 settlements are flooded. The water has receded from Darivka, Ingults, Yasna Polyana, Zarichne, Kozatske, and Kamyanka. 1509 houses remain underwater. During the day the water receded from 140 houses," - he noted.
According to Prokudin, explosives experts have already examined over 168 hectares of territory, 118 of which are in Kherson's Ostrov neighborhood. No explosives have been found there so far. Source: https://censor.net/ua/n3425243
